Situation
Banbury is a thriving, market town located just north of Oxford amidst beautiful rolling countryside. The town is steeped in history and is now a modern centre with a full range of shops, supermarkets, a cinema, restaurants and leisure facilities.
Communication links are excellent with Junction 11 of the M40 situated approximately two miles north east. Banbury railway station is within walking distance and provides regular trains to all parts of the country with London and Birmingham a comfortable commute (London Marylebone from 57 minutes and Birmingham New Street from 44 minutes). Birmingham Airport is about 40 miles distant and Heathrow and Luton Airports are also within easy reach.
The local area provides a range of primary, secondary and boarding schools; the well regarded Harriers Academy and St Marys schools are located nearby.
